Reflect & Prepare

Friday, 21st June 2019 14:24 - by Rajan Dhall

All eyes were on this week's FOMC and as the projections all leaned towards a dovish message, Fed chair Powell did not disappoint, leaving the door open to rate cuts due to global risks permeating through to the US economy.  In subtle rhetoric, Jerome Powell managed to negotiate a tricky meeting, which had been hyped up for a number of weeks and pressured not only by the US president but also bond markets - which saw the benchmark 10yr Note slipping briefly under 2.0%.  All this was good news for equities, with the S&P 500 tipping new all-time highs.  

Markets are now pricing in a full 25bp cut in July, with some pundits looking for the Fed to go the whole hog and lop 50bps off the Fed funds.  Either way, market calm was maintained with the Dollar losing some ground to boot - so we can assume the president was also left happy with the results.  

 

On the political front, the Twitter-sphere has been dominated by comments on Iran, while the trade spat with China seems to have been put on hold with G20 now in focus.  The two leaders are due to meet for an extended meeting the week after next.  On Iran, reports on Friday suggested the US was close to initiating military strikes in response to a drone being shot down, but the president is said to have pulled back at the last minute.  

 

The final two candidates for the PM job have been decided, with Jeremy Hunt joining the favourite Boris Johnson Tory party vote which as to go through a month of hustings starting from this weekend in Birmingham.  The schedule finishes in London, with the final votes counted on the weekend before the announcement on Monday 22nd of July.  The odds are over 90% in favour of Mr. Johnson, but Hunt's campaign naturally promises to give him a run for his money, though it is fair to say that this is Boris Johnson's contest to lose.

 

The Bank of England met midweek, and despite hawkish comments from some of the MPC members recently, all 9 voted for rates to stay on hold.  Q2 growth projections were revised down to flat from 0.2% with the Brexit delay clearly causing hesitation in industry as many feared.  The 'Bank' also saw wage growth leveling off, though they maintained that gradual tightening was still required.  The market was and is not convinced.

 

Movers and Losers

 

Ashtead group +11%: Co. reported a 17 per cent rise in annual profits to GBP 1.1billion. Revenues also increased by 19 per cent to GBP 4.5billion.

 

Carnival -12.62%: The Co. struggled this week as it revealed that some of its operations in Cuba have been shut due to a travel ban. Almost GBP 3bln has been wiped off the market cap.

 

Dixons -8.85%: The electrical retail firm continues to struggle with its mobile business as phone contract lengths hit the business. 

 

Westminster Group +94%:  Co. set up a joint venture to capitalise as Saudi Arabia privatises transport infrastructure.
